Decoding Custom Retail Boxes: Substrate Selection & Structural Mechanics

In modern retail environments—ranging from mass-market department stores to high-end boutique storefronts and direct-to-consumer (DTC) fulfillment hubs—custom retail boxes serve a dual functional mandate: they act as a brand’s primary structural shield and its silent salesman. Global procurement directors and brand managers frequently query AI engines and search platforms on how to optimize caliper weight, structural stability, and surface printability. Achieving the ideal ratio between cost, durability, and aesthetics requires a clear technical understanding of paperboard grades and flute profiles.

The foundation of any high-performing custom retail box rests upon selecting the correct paperboard substrate. Below is an engineering overview of the primary materials manufactured at Custom Box Makers:

Substrate Type Caliper / Thickness Range Structural Rigidity Primary Retail Application Recyclability Rating
C1S / C2S Paperboard (Coated Solid Bleached) 12pt to 24pt (250–500 GSM) Moderate flexural strength; smooth printing surface Cosmetics, pharmaceuticals, lightweight retail goods, tuck boxes 100% Recyclable
Virgin Kraft Paperboard (Unbleached) 14pt to 28pt (280–550 GSM) High tensile strength & tear resistance Organic foods, eco-conscious apparel, artisanal soaps, heavy candles 100% Biodegradable & Compostable
E-Flute Corrugated (Micro-Flute) 1/16" (1.5mm thickness) High crush resistance; structural stacking capability Retail mailers, shelf-ready display boxes, subscription packaging 100% Recyclable (High PCR Content)
Rigid Chipboard (Greyboard Core) 60pt to 120pt (1.5mm–3.0mm solid core) Maximum load-bearing & shape retention Luxury electronics, jewelry, high-end gift sets, spirits Recyclable Core (FSC Certified)

Calculating Unit Economics vs. Structural Integrity

A recurring question asked by procurement professionals is: "How do we decrease unit shipping weight without compromising box crush strength during palletizing?" The technical solution lies in structural die-line engineering. By utilizing precision CAD die-lines with reinforced auto-locking bottoms or double-wall tuck fronts, brands can reduce caliper thickness by 10% to 15% while retaining identical edge-crush test (ECT) values. This approach significantly lowers material consumption and freight tariffs without risking product damage.

1. Strict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) & Plastic-Free Mandates

Global regulatory frameworks across North America, the European Union, and Australia are tightening restrictions on non-recyclable plastic laminates and single-use packaging components. Future retail box procurement requires 100% plastic-free window films (such as wood-pulp acetate), aqueous coatings replacing poly-lamination, and soy/water-based printing inks. B2B buyers who transition early avoid carbon taxes and strengthen brand standing among eco-conscious shoppers.

2. Smart Retail Packaging with Embedded NFC & Dynamic QR Nodes

The barrier between brick-and-mortar retail and digital brand ecosystems is disappearing. Next-generation custom retail boxes incorporate micro-printed high-density QR codes and flexible RFID/NFC chips directly within structural paperboard layers. This allows shoppers to verify product authenticity, review ingredient origins, unlock augmented reality (AR) interactive guides, and reorder products seamlessly with a smartphone scan.

3. Micro-Batch Sourcing & Rapid Inventory Optimization

Holding vast stockpiles of custom packaging creates cash flow bottlenecks and risk of obsolescence due to rapid SKU iterations. The industry is moving toward dynamic print-on-demand models. Enterprise buyers now demand zero MOQ flexibilities with rapid production cycles (under 10 days), enabling agile seasonal campaigns, localized promotional runs, and reduced warehousing costs.

4. Generative AI Structural Dieline Engineering & Virtual Prototyping

Artificial Intelligence tools are revolutionizing structural box design. Modern packaging engineers leverage AI algorithms to run simulated drop-tests and load-stress evaluations on digital twin models. This process optimizes paperboard layout yield by up to 22%, reducing raw material waste during die-cutting while cutting prototype cycle times from weeks down to hours.

Always measure the maximum length, width, and depth of your product (or inner product container), including any protective inserts or secondary wrapping. We recommend adding a structural tolerance margin of 1/16" (1.5mm) to 1/8" (3mm) to internal dimensions to ensure smooth insertion without causing seam stress or paperboard tearing.
We require vector artwork files in Adobe Illustrator (.AI), PDF, or EPS format, with all fonts converted to outlines and images embedded at a minimum resolution of 300 DPI. Artwork must be set up in the CMYK color space or designated Pantone (PMS) spot color layers. Our structural prepress team will verify your artwork against the custom dieline prior to plate making.

Packaging manufacturing operates on significant economies of scale. While we have zero minimum order requirements (No MOQ), unit costs drop rapidly as order quantities increase from 100 to 500, 1,000, 5,000, or 10,000+ units. This cost reduction occurs because fixed machine setup, plate engraving, and die-cutting costs are amortized over a larger quantity of printed boxes.
